Damon: 'Informant! script was jaw-dropping'

In the Steven Soderbergh movie, the actor plays real-life ex-Archer Daniels Midland executive and whistleblower Mark Whitacre.
Damon told Parade: "Reading the book and the script, my jaw was on the floor. You can't make these things up. It was a whistleblower story unlike any I'd ever heard.
"This guy was doing these incredibly courageous things, wearing a wire and gathering all of this information about price fixing. At the same time he was embezzling money from the company he was exposing and the FBI had no idea."
He added: "The funny part is that he was a brilliant executive on the rise. But he was battling his own kind of mental health issues. He couldn't help himself.
"Even predating this whole story, he was telling people that he was adopted by a family after his parents had died in an automobile accident and none of it was true."
